Voir les contributions

Cette section vous permet de consulter les contributions (messages, sujets et fichiers joints) d'un utilisateur. Vous ne pourrez voir que les contributions des zones auxquelles vous avez accès.


Messages - Alain LM

Pages: [1]
1
Bonjour,

Je souhaite réaliser des petites animations lumineuses (LED) pour mon réseau avec un ATtiny programmé via Arduino.
Ma question concerne l'alimentation de l'ATtiny. Dois-je prévoir une alimentation spécifique ou puis-je me repiquer sur le bus DCC qui court tout le long du réseau, moyennant un redresseur (pont de diodes) et un régulateur de tension (type LM7805) ?
L'ATtiny a une faible consommation donc ça ne devrait pas trop tirer sur la centrale DCC, mais je suis plutôt sceptique quant à la stabilité d'une telle alimentation.

Merci d'avance pour vos conseils.

2
Bibliothèques / Re : Gestion de multiples LEDs en parallèle
« le: juillet 28, 2016, 03:09:09 pm »
... une bibliothèque pour des effets lumineux (Forge, Cheminée,Soudeur,etc...) mais pour des leds WS2812...

 :D  Dans le même esprit, mais plus sophistiqué me semble-t-il.
Ma bibliothèque s'adresse à des LEDs "de base".

3
Bibliothèques / Re : Gestion de multiples LEDs en parallèle
« le: juillet 26, 2016, 12:10:51 pm »
Et si je n'ai fait que réinventer l'eau chaude  :-[, tant pis, ça m'a permis de me dérouiller en programmation C++.

 ??? J'ai effectivement mal cherché puisqu'un peu plus loin sur ce forum est présenté une librairie d'animations lumineuses, néanmoins beaucoup plus sophistiquée que ce que j'ai réalisé.

4
Bibliothèques / Gestion de multiples LEDs en parallèle
« le: juillet 26, 2016, 11:55:45 am »
Bonjour,

En réalisant un TCO pour commander les itinéraires dans une zone d'aiguilles, j'ai eu besoin de gérer l'allumage et l’extinction de plusieurs LEDs en parallèle, fixe ou clignotant, temporisé ou pas.
Si la plupart des exemples de programmes Arduino utilisent la fonction delay(), vous savez sûrement tous que cette fonction est bloquante et qu'il faut utiliser autre chose pour gérer plusieurs LEDs en parallèle. Il y a plein d'exemples sur la toile qui expliquent ce qu'il faut faire (par exemple  ici).

Comme ce TCO était ma première réalisation concrète en Arduino, j'ai décidé de réaliser par moi-même une librairie de gestion de multiples LEDs, pour me faire la main. Je n'ai pas fait une recherche très approfondie, mais je n'ai pas trouvé de librairie toute faite qui fasse la même chose ou similaire. Étonnant ! :o Peut-être trop simple ?

Vous trouverez cette librairie sur mon compte GitHub.
Par déformation (professionnelle) je travaille plutôt en anglais, mais la description des méthodes est bilingue anglais-français dans le Wiki.

Cela fonctionne parfaitement sur le TCO avec une vingtaine de LEDs.

Je compte étendre la librairie avec d'autres effets, comme gyrophare, flicker, fade-in, fade-out, soudure à l'arc, etc. En bref tout ce que l'on retrouve couramment dans les décodeurs de loco ou d'accessoires.

En espérant que ça puisse être utile à vos projets.

Les contributions pour de nouveaux effets ou améliorations sont les bienvenues. ;D

Et si je n'ai fait que réinventer l'eau chaude  :-[, tant pis, ça m'a permis de me dérouiller en programmation C++.

5
Présentez vous ! / Bonjour, nouveau venu à l'Arduino
« le: juillet 26, 2016, 11:27:24 am »
Bonjour,

Je me suis lancé dans l'Arduino il y a quelques mois, après discussions avec des collègues qui avaient déjà pas mal joué avec. Je suis ingénieur automaticien dans une boite d'ingénieur en électronique et informatique temps-réel, alors forcément ça (dé)forme.  8)

Je pratique aussi le modélisme, à l’échelle N. Je fréquence le club T.E.N. de Massy, dont certains membres s’intéressent aussi à l'Arduino.

Notre modeste réseau N avait besoin d'un TCO pour commander le faisceau et la zone d'aiguilles et j'ai trouvé un cas d'application pratique pour conjuguer les deux passe-temps. Je viens de finir ce projet qui est maintenant opérationnel et que je peux décrire dans un autre fil pour ceux que ça intéresse.

J'en ai dérivé une librairie de gestion de LEDs que j'évoque sur un autre fil.

Pages: [1]